Showa-era Japanese Enamel Sign Nissan Chemical "PCP Combi"
Bold, striking, and unmistakably Showa in design, this authentic Japanese enamel advertising sign promotes **"PCP Combi"**, a product manufactured by **Nissan Chemical Industries (Nissan Kagaku)**. The vivid contrast of bright yellow lettering against a deep cobalt blue background, crowned by Nissan's iconic red-and-white star emblem, creates a visual impact characteristic of mid-20th-century Japanese commercial art.
During the decades following World War II, Japan underwent a period of rapid agricultural modernization. In an effort to improve productivity and secure stable food supplies for a growing population, farmers increasingly turned to scientifically developed fertilizers and crop-protection products. Companies such as Nissan Chemical played a pivotal role in this transformation, supplying innovative agricultural solutions to farming communities across the country.
From a design perspective, this piece embodies the timeless appeal of Japanese enamel signage. The clean typography, geometric composition, and limited yet powerful color palette were carefully chosen for maximum visibility. Even today, the graphic quality feels remarkably modern, making it equally suitable as a decorative object in contemporary interiors.
Agricultural enamel signs are considerably rarer than advertisements for beverages or household goods, as many were discarded once farming practices evolved and regulations changed. Surviving examples, especially those associated with major industrial firms such as Nissan Chemical, are increasingly sought after by collectors interested in Japan's industrial heritage and rural history.
More than a nostalgic advertising piece, this sign captures a defining moment in Japan's post-war story—when innovation met tradition, and scientific advancement reshaped the nation's fields and communities.
Today, it stands as both a compelling work of graphic design and a fascinating historical artifact: a reminder of the era when the future of Japanese agriculture was written in enamel and steel.
